Overview

In 1980, attorney Michael Riley founded our law firm, the Law Office of Michael Riley P.C. in Rensselaer, Indiana, as a way to serve the citizens of our community and help them with all of their legal needs. Now, almost 40 years later, Mr. Riley and his associate attorney, Jacob Ahler, continue to provide the highest level of representation possible to our clients in the following practice areas:

  • Personal injury
  • Wrongful death
  • Appellate practice
  • Adoptions
  • Business formations and transactions
  • Criminal defense
  • DUI defense/specialized driving permits
  • Expungements
  • Estates, wills and trusts
  • Family law
  • Guardianships
  • Professional licensing defense

Over the course of our history, our law firm has helped thousands of clients throughout Jasper County and the surrounding areas with their most pressing and sensitive legal issues. With more than 50 years of experience practicing law, Mr. Riley has handled a wide variety of cases, including several death penalty cases, and he currently serves as chief public defender for Jasper County. Mr. Ahler is also a public defender for White County, and he focuses primarily on estate planning, civil and commercial litigation, and criminal defense.

How do I choose a lawyer?

Consider the following:

  • Comfort Level – Are you comfortable telling the lawyer personal information? Does the lawyer seem interested in solving your problem?
  • Credentials – How long has the lawyer been in practice? Has the lawyer worked on other cases similar to yours?
  • Cost – How are the lawyer's fees structured — hourly or flat fee? Can the lawyer estimate the cost of your case?
  • City – Is the lawyer's office conveniently located?

Not sure what questions to ask a lawyer?

Here are a few to get you started:

  • How long have you been in practice?
  • How many cases like mine have you handled?
  • How often do you settle cases out of court?
  • What are your fees and costs?
  • What are the next steps?

Want to check lawyer discipline?

It is always a good idea to research your lawyer prior to hiring. Every state has a disciplinary organization that monitors attorneys, their licenses, and consumer complaints. By researching lawyer discipline you can:

  • Ensure the attorney is currently licensed to practice in your state
  • Gain an understanding of his or her historical disciplinary record, if any.
  • Determine the seriousness of complaints/issues which could range from late bar fees to more serious issues requiring disciplinary action.
